*The picking acoustic guitar part is tuned as follows
from lowest string to highest: DGDAAE
The verses are then played only picking the 3rd, 4th, and 5th string.
All the chords only use one finger and are fretted on the 5th string.
So, a D chord is 7th fret, A 6th fret, Bm 4th fret, and G is open-
all fretted on the 5th, now tuned G string.
The only exception to the one-fingered chords is the Em.
It is played 6th string 2nd fret, and 4th string 2nd fret.
